Good evening HC family.
So my HC Charger broke down. The guy who was working on my car, did it in one location and was bringing it back to me in another. He was driving it on the highway (going 75) when he seen a bunch of white smoke and oil splatter out from the hood vents. No CEL appeared and the car was running fine he claims.. Only the smoke gave it away as far as a issue occurred. He pulled off the highway and pulled into a parking lot and said a bunch of oil poured out from where the filter is. It’s at the dealership now, waiting to get diagnosed. I did have valet mode set prior to giving him the key. Has anyone else had this issue? I’m wondering would it could be. Any feedback is appreciated!

Any chance a new filter was put on recently? Not unheard of for the gasket of the old filter sticking on the car and being overlooked. New filter goes on and leaks as the new gasket can't seal to the old gasket.

If not that it could be an oil cooler line failure.

What was worked on buy the guy driving the car?

No chance it's the catch can. That would be an insane amount of oil being pushed through it to make that big of a mess. If the cap fell of when it was full, maybe, but that amount of oil from a running car, not a chance. If it is the catch can he's got major issues with that engine.

FYI on what an oil cooler line leak can look like. Pretty close to this car but I think this car is even worse. I'm still thinking line or filter gasket.
